Top 10 Best South Los Angeles Public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 202 public schools serving 95,546 students in the neighborhood of South Los Angeles, Los Angeles, CA.
The top ranked public schools in South Los Angeles are Middle College High School, Orthopaedic Hospital and Benjamin Banneker Career And Transition Center.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
The neighborhood of South Los Angeles, Los Angeles, CA public schools have an average math proficiency score of 19% (versus the California public school average of 34%), and reading proficiency score of 40% (versus the 49%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 99%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the California public school average of 79% (majority Hispanic).
